How they compare
Egypt currently reports 31.73 billion against 21.90 billion in Slovakia, a difference of 9.83 billion.
That makes Egypt's figure about 1.4 times Slovakia's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 6 shared years of data; in 2003 it was Slovakia ahead.
Egypt ranks 17th and Slovakia ranks 18th of 106 countries.
Slovakia has averaged higher in every one of the 1 decades both report.
